About
PHOTON-TD is the highest-power variant in the PHOTON solar array family, featuring triple-deployable wing panels for maximum solar collection area. Designed for power-intensive CubeSat and small satellite missions up to 16U, it provides the greatest energy generation of the PHOTON range. All three wings deploy passively using spring mechanisms and the system integrates with AAC Clyde Space PCDU/EPS products using high-efficiency triple junction solar cells.
